Skip to main content

Channels

Channels let your Vecbase agent communicate through messaging platforms. Users can chat with the agent directly in Telegram, Feishu, Discord, or Slack — the agent responds automatically.

How It Works

  1. You connect a messaging platform to your agent (one-time setup)
  2. Users send messages to the bot on that platform
  3. Your agent reads the message, thinks, and responds automatically
  4. The response appears directly in the chat

Supported Platforms

Telegram

Connect via BotFather bot token

飞书 (Feishu)

Connect via Open Platform app credentials

Discord

Connect via Developer Portal bot token

Slack

Connect via Slack API bot + app tokens

Adding a Channel

  1. Open your agent and tap Settings
  2. Click the Channels tab
  3. Click Add Channel next to the platform you want
  4. Follow the platform-specific setup guide
  5. Enter your credentials and click Create
The channel will connect automatically. You’ll see the status change to Connected.

What Your Agent Can Do Through Channels

FeatureDescription
Text repliesResponds to messages automatically
Send & receive filesShare documents, images, and other files
@MentionsMention specific users in group chats
Group chatsParticipate in group conversations
Multi-channelConnect multiple platforms to the same agent
Feishu DocsCreate and edit Feishu documents, wikis, and bitables
Your agent handles all the technical details automatically. Just connect the channel and start chatting!